Understanding PDC Bits in Mining Exploration
PDC (Polycrystalline Diamond Compact) bits have revolutionized the mining exploration industry due to their exceptional performance and durability. Unlike traditional drill bits, PDC bits are made with synthetic diamond material, which allows them to withstand extreme conditions encountered during drilling. This innovation has led to increased efficiency and reduced operational costs for mining companies.
The design of PDC bits allows for a smoother drilling process, reducing friction and wear. As a result, these bits can penetrate harder rock formations faster than conventional bits, making them ideal for various mining applications. Furthermore, the lifespan of PDC bits is significantly longer, enabling mining operations to maximize their output while minimizing downtime for bit replacements.
Advantages of Using PDC Bits
One of the primary advantages of PDC bits is their ability to maintain sharp cutting edges throughout the drilling process. This characteristic is crucial when dealing with challenging geological formations, as it ensures consistent drilling performance. The efficiency gained from using PDC bits translates to lower drilling costs and improved overall productivity for mining projects.
In addition to their cutting efficiency, PDC bits are also known for their versatility. They can be used in both soft and hard rock formations, making them suitable for a wide range of mining exploration tasks. This adaptability allows mining companies to streamline their operations by utilizing a single type of drill bit across various drilling conditions.

The Future of PDC Bit Technology
As technology continues to advance, the PDC bit is expected to evolve further, incorporating new materials and design innovations. Researchers are exploring ways to enhance the thermal stability and wear resistance of PDC bits, which could lead to even longer service lives and improved performance in extreme conditions. These advancements will likely drive the adoption of PDC bits in more demanding mining environments.
Moreover, the integration of smart technologies, such as sensors and data analytics, into PDC bit design holds promising potential. By monitoring the performance of PDC bits in real-time, mining companies can optimize their drilling strategies, resulting in better resource extraction and reduced environmental impact. This trend towards smarter, more efficient drilling solutions signifies a bright future for PDC technology in the mining exploration sector.
